海南岛近海B106柱粘土矿物学指标的古气候环境意义 被引量:3

Paleoclimate Environmental Significance of Clay Mineral Analysis of Core B106 at Offshore Hainan Island
下载PDF
导出
摘要 通过对海南岛近海B106沉积柱粘土矿物的定性、定量分析,依据其AMS14C定年数据,参照对比前人采用其它研究方法和研究对象获得的古气候环境事件结论,提出用(伊-蒙混层矿物+伊利石)/高岭石([I/S+I]/K)含量比值的矿物学指标来指示古气候环境事件。结果显示B106柱的粘土矿物学指标指示出14 775 BC以来的7次古气候事件,说明在一定条件下利用海洋沉积柱粘土矿物组合、含量的变化特点,也可以揭示万年尺度内的古气候环境事件。 Qualitative and quantitative analysis of the clay mineral in the offshore sedimentary core B106 was used to indicate the paleoclimate environmental events. According to the dating result from AMS14C and formal studies, the content ratio (about illite-smectite interstratified clay minerals + illite) vs kao- linite ([-I/S+I]/K) was proposed to achieve the indication. The clay minerals in the sedimentary core sample B106 presented seven paleoclimate events since 14 775 BC. Such a study showed that the clay mineral in the marine sedimentary core of the offshore of Hainan Island could reveal the paleoclimate environmental events within 10ka scales.
